09242001 - Thank goodness, Torbjörn came through with the MP3 fix. Apparently
SMPEG mixes each chunk of decoded data with whatever is already
in the buffer you give it. I hate that. I'm going to patch SMPEG
to let the programmer enable and disable that behaviour in a given
(SMPEG *), since it's just a CPU eater in this case. The _D(())
macro is now SNDDBG(()), since _D is taken on MacOS X's version of
gcc (which was bound to happen on some platform sooner than later
anyhow). Renamed test_sdlsound to playsound, and made it more
robust in general: fixed potential overflow in audio_callback,
made it chatter less, made it take multiple files and some other
command lines. Initial autoconf support, thanks to Max Horn.
09222001 - Torbjörn Andersson strikes again, with a collection of patches.
First, some cosmetic tweaks for decoders/aiff.c. Next, a MOD player
based on MikMod. This inspired me to add two more methods to
Sound_DecoderFunctions: init() and quit(). Third, a fix to
decoders/mp3.c so that SMPEG won't claim every stream it sees, MP3
or not. I removed the multiple-streams-per-rwops code, after
discussion on the mailing list. The init() and quit() methods
led to the possibility that certain decoders will flag themselves
as unavailable at runtime, and SDL_sound now handles this.
Added [LIB|INC]PATH_[OGG|MOD]. Bigendian fixes; now works on
PowerPC Linux. MikMod tweaks. Changed version to 0.1.2.
